Even I am much into online poker, I would choose Phil Ivey's ability to read opponents. Poker is much about understanding human behavior. Ivey is known for noticing even the smallest cues: changes in betting pace, nuances in body language or reactions hat are not in line with the situation. This makes him a dangerous opponent, as he knows the way how to adapt his game according to what he is observing.

Negreanu’s hand-reading ability.

He seems to instantly know ranges and what his opponents are capable of doing, which is insane. That skill alone turns marginal situations into big edges—without needing perfect cards or fancy bluffs.
